Canned tuna (in water) vs Turkey breast (raw): which protein is cheaper?
USDA macros joined to current US grocery prices, reduced to the two numbers that decide it: dollars per gram of protein, and protein per calorie.
Canned tuna (in water) is 1.0x cheaper per gram of protein ($0.042/g vs $0.044/g), while it also carries more protein per calorie (22.4 g vs 21.6 g per 100 kcal), so it wins on both axes.
| Food | $/g protein | 30 g protein costs | You need | kcal that come with it | Protein/100 kcal |
|---|---|---|---|---|---|
| Canned tuna (in water) | $0.042 | $1.27 | 115 g | 134 kcal | 22.4 g |
| Turkey breast (raw) | $0.044 | $1.31 | 125 g | 139 kcal | 21.6 g |
Full macros, per serving
| Food (per serving) | Price | kcal | Protein | Carbs | Fat |
|---|---|---|---|---|---|
| Canned tuna (in water) (100 g) | $1.10 | 116 | 26 g | 0 g | 1 g |
| Turkey breast (raw) (100 g) | $1.05 | 111 | 24 g | 0 g | 1 g |
A week of protein from each
Hitting a common 100 g/day protein target from canned tuna (in water) alone costs $29.62 a week; from turkey breast (raw) alone, $30.63. That is a gap of $1.01 every week for the same protein.
